In this chapter it is told how to use palette History (History), selectively to cancel to 99 operations on editing, to each of which there corresponds a certain state of the image. Also you learn how to recover the selected areas of images by means of tool History Brush (the Recovering paintbrush) or Art History Brush (the Art recovering paintbrush.), filling the selected area with the image corresponding to any state, or erasing from the image result of the subsequent operations of editing.

Palette History (History) contains the list of the last operations fulfilled over the image, and the lowermost element of the list represents the latest operation. If to click on any previous element of the list, the image will be recovered till the specified moment of editing. That immediately happens to the image, depends on in what mode there is a palette - linear or non-linear, therefore it is very important to understand, than these modes differ.
